Hessian students currently have exchange opportunities with the USA (Wisconsin), Canada (Alberta) and France within the framework of the Brigitte Sauzay Programme and the Voltaire Programme. The duration of the stay varies depending on the exchange program.
German-American Student Exchange
As part of the German-American student exchange, around 15 Hessian students at general education schools can visit American host families in the Hessian partner state of Wisconsin for five months each year. The return visit takes place the following year and is scheduled to last three months.
German-Canadian Student Exchange
As part of the German-Canadian student exchange, around 15 to 20 Hessian students aged 15 to 16 can visit host families in the province of Alberta every year and in return host the Canadian partner. The German and Canadian students stay in their respective partner countries for three months.
Exchange with France: Brigitte Sauzay Programme and Voltaire Programme
Under both programmes, students can improve their language skills and intercultural competences. The Brigitte Sauzay programme is aimed at students in grades 8 to 11 who have been learning French for at least two years. For the Voltaire Programme, German students are recommended by their school, at the time of application they attend the 9th or 10th grade.
Information on the student exchange programmes can be obtained from the "Service Agency International Encounters" at the State Education Office in Rüsselsheim am Main. However, the service centre cannot advise on all aspects of individual student exchanges. In such cases, please contact the school management of your school.
